Problem- The solubility of carbon dioxide in water is 0.161g CO2 in 100mL of water at 20 degree Celsius and 1.00 atm. A soft drink is carbonated with carbon dioxide gas at 5.50 atm pressure. What is the solubility of carbon dioxide in water at this pressure?
